Cedar Grove-Belgium kept a clean sheet against Grafton on Thursday. They were the clear victors by an 8-0 margin over the Black Hawks. The victory made it back-to-back wins for Cedar Grove-Belgium.
Cedar Grove-Belgium's victory bumped their record up to 2-0. As for Grafton,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 0-2.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Cedar Grove-Belgium will challenge Fond du Lac at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Grafton, they will look to defend their home pitch on Thursday against Augustine Prep at 7:00 p.m.
